Title: | Debian Security Advisory DSA 3822-1 (gstreamer1.0 - security update) |
Summary: | Hanno Boeck discovered multiple vulnerabilities in the GStreamer media;framework and its codecs and demuxers, which may result in denial of;service or the execution of arbitrary code if a malformed media file is;opened. |
Description: | Summary: Hanno Boeck discovered multiple vulnerabilities in the GStreamer media framework and its codecs and demuxers, which may result in denial of service or the execution of arbitrary code if a malformed media file is opened. Affected Software/OS: gstreamer1.0 on Debian Linux Solution: For the stable distribution (jessie), this problem has been fixed in version 1.4.4-2+deb8u1. For the upcoming stable distribution (stretch), this problem has been fixed in version 1.10.3-1. For the unstable distribution (sid), this problem has been fixed in version version 1.10.3-1. We recommend that you upgrade your gstreamer1.0 packages. CVSS Score: 5.0 CVSS Vector: AV:N/AC:L/Au:N/C:N/I:N/A:P |
